need help in finding a string and to send an email using shell script

Hi All

i am writing a shell script which will search for a string "expires". once the search string is found it has to give the email address as the output and send an email to the person

This is basically to find the encrypetd keys which are loaded in the unix server

Below are sample keys not the true values:

p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n@fund.com>
s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-06-22]


once i run the shell script it will execute the command gpg --list-keys and then search for the string and the output should be like this ::

unicorn01516008 <uniccrn@fund.com> Expires on 2008-06-22 and this has to be emailed to some xxxx@xxxx.com

can you please help me in giving me some sample code !!!

Thanks a lot for your help!!!

Tools Try this one...

Code:
#! /bin/bash

admin=me@mycompany.com

rm sample_key.mat 2>/dev/null
cat sample_key.txt | grep "expire" >sample_key.mat

while read zf
   do
#      echo $zf
      fld1=$(echo $zf | cut -d" " -f4)
      fld2=$(echo $zf | cut -d" " -f5)
      fld3=$(echo $zf | cut -d" " -f9)
      fld4=$(echo $zf | cut -d" " -f10)

      subj="Expiring certificate"  
      mesg="$fld1 $fld2 $fld3 $fld4"
      echo $mesg

      echo "$mesg" | mailx -s "$subj" "$admin" 


done < sample_key.mat

rm sample_key.mat 2>/dev/null

Make sure to adjust the admin variable at the top. Seemed to work with a file which I used as a sample:

Code:
cat sample_key.txt
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n1@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-06-22]
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n2@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-07-22]
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n3@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-08-22]
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n4@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n5@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-09-22]
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n6@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02
pub 5858D/58585255EF 2007-10-02 unicorn01516008 <uniccrn7@fund.com> sub 452659g/97974545df 2007-10-02 [expires: 2008-07-22]
